Output f343339822ec4e6cf3b9078ea7a655bde78a75d6f4384feee699e22cf3ea1919:9

value
8554976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fb8166ec5e609c052a275f99e632f789b7e4ff OP_EQUAL
address
36XAMRehFYX7yVmKZPszitkuNpcUJ23pX5
transaction
f343339822ec4e6cf3b9078ea7a655bde78a75d6f4384feee699e22cf3ea1919
confirmations
179662
spent
true